Farewell Yellow Brick Road


Last month we went to see one of the greatest legends of all time in concert - Sir Elton John.  I've seen Elton several times live, but when he announced his Farewell Yellow Brick Road tour was going to be his final ever, I knew I had to go see him one last time.  Elton John is one of my absolute favorites - I grew up listening to his music and dancing along - and this final tour did not disappoint at all.  He played all of his hits {the show lasted 3 hours!} and I alternated between trying to record some of my faves {Levon, Someone Saved My Life Tonight - see snippets below!} and just sitting and soaking up the live versions of these iconic songs.  He had some great stories in between songs while the screen behind him showed great montages of his past 50 years {!} on tour, and he left us with the simple message of "let's be a little nicer to each other". It was such a privilege to be there for his last show in these parts and to introduce Christian to his first Elton show - something I know we'll both remember for a very long time.
